Transaction 91f40562cf9128f0f75c611960ce633f4a36a99184eccda209178ec995fa5d75
1 Input
1 Output
-
91f40562cf9128f0f75c611960ce633f4a36a99184eccda209178ec995fa5d75:0
- value
- 21229020
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d55a09d126b511b54522447602e26b15314d4c3
- address
- bc1qm426p8gjddg3k4zjy3rkqt3xk9f3f4xrjdcjh0